VOCES: Latino Vote 2024

Tuesday, Oct. 22 at 9 p.m. 

Examine the priorities of a politically diverse Latino electorate in the run-up to the 2024 presidential election in some of the most hotly contested battleground states, including Arizona, Florida and Pennsylvania as well as California and Florida.

This program will be available for members to stream with Arizona PBS Passport beginning on Wednesday, Oct. 9, ahead of the broadcast premiere on Tuesday, Oct. 22.
